1. 程式人生 > >window2008下基於阿里雲免費HTTPS證書+apache2.4.27的HTTPS配置方法

window2008下基於阿里雲免費HTTPS證書+apache2.4.27的HTTPS配置方法

         最近公司要開發小程式,小程式需要用到HTTPS,於是選擇了阿里雲的免費HTTPS證書。在win2008系統下配置失敗了很多次,總算也配置成功了,網上的一些配置方式都比較零散不正確 於是我把我的配置過程整理出來和大家分享,以節省大家的時間。 1: 我的Apache版本是2.4.27  php版本5.5.28 2: 要有阿里雲賬號和基於阿里雲的域名,登陸阿里雲->管理控制檯->產品與服務->證書服務 3: 按照證書服務中的提示,補全域名資訊(一級域名或者二級域名)、個人資訊 如圖所示: 注意證書驗證型別:DNS , 證書繫結的域名 必須勾選,其中域名在阿里雲域名管理裡面必須已經存在

4: 提交申請後,如果你的域名已經申請好並且在阿里雲域名管理中已經存在,則 以上操作會自動在域名管理裡面生成一個TXT記錄,該記錄用來驗證域名是否是你自己的,此步驟如果成功,大約一天時間會申請證書成功。如下圖所示: 注意:阿里證書在你的域名管理裡面自動建立一個TXT記錄後,代表已經驗證成功,刪除自動建立的TXT記錄,手動在你的域名下增加一個A記錄(我新增的A記錄是一個二級域名)和你申請證書的域名必須保持一致,A記錄解析成功之後,接著再往下配置。
5: 點下載證書:選擇Apache 下載有四個檔案,四個檔案放置在 Apache根目錄下 如:D:\Apache\Apache24\cert  下 ,然後配置D:\Apache\Apache24\conf\httpd.conf 檔案:        1):在httpd.conf檔案中去掉 Include conf/extra/httpd-ssl.conf  前面的註釋 #        2):在httpd.conf檔案中去掉 LoadModule ssl_module modules/mod_ssl.so 前面的註釋#       3):在https.conf檔案中去掉 LoadModule socache_shmcb_module modules/mod_socache_shmcb.so 前面的# 6:步驟5配置完畢後接著配置  D:\Apache\Apache24\conf\extra\httpd-ssl.conf 檔案:             在httpd-ssl.conf 中配置https 虛擬主機 ,請按照以下方式配置每一項:                   #
新增 SSL 協議支援協議,去掉不安全的協議修改如下 SSLProtocol all -SSLv2 -SSLv3 #修改加密套件如下 SSLCipherSuite HIGH:!RC4:!MD5:!aNULL:!eNULL:!NULL:!DH:!EDH:!EXP:+MEDIUM SSLHonorCipherOrder on                  <VirtualHost 125.733.11.22:443>     #ip必須配置                    DocumentRoot "E:\www\mywebsite”      #網頁路徑                    ServerName
apis.xxxxxx.com
                  #你的https域名 阿里雲申請繫結證書的域名和你在域名管理中解析的A記錄域名                    SSLEngine on                       SSLCertificateFile "D:/Apache/Apache24/cert/public.pem”    # 證書路徑公鑰  之前步驟已經把4個申請號的檔案放在了cert目錄下                    SSLCertificateKeyFile "D:/Apache/Apache24/cert/214213333310195.key”  # 私鑰                    SSLCertificateChainFile "D:/Apache/Apache24/cert/chain.pem”                   # 證書鏈                     #CustomLog "c:/Apache24/logs/ssl_request.log” \    # 此日誌路徑前面的註釋必須去掉  不然Apache無法啟動 7:以上操作和配置確定無誤後 啟動Apache服務,完成配置,瀏覽器輸入你的域名https://apis.xxxx.com 驗證。

相關推薦

window2008基於阿里免費HTTPS證書+apache2.4.27的HTTPS配置方法

         最近公司要開發小程式,小程式需要用到HTTPS,於是選擇了阿里雲的免費HTTPS證書。在win2008系統下配置失敗了很多次,總算也配置成功了,網上的一些配置方式都比較零散不正確 於是我把我的配置過程整理出來和大家分享,以節省大家的時間。 1: 我的Apache版本是2.4.27  php

阿里免費Https證書申請使用

超文字傳輸安全協議(英語:Hypertext Transfer Protocol Secure,縮寫:HTTPS,常稱為HTTP over TLS,HTTP over SSL或HTTP Secure)是一種透過計算機網路進行安全通訊的傳輸協議。HTTPS經由

阿里免費DV證書Nginx配置https

首先去阿里雲申請一個證書, 這裡說是購買,支付0元, 選擇免費型DV證書購買既可,然後可以看到證書列表裡面有個空的證書,補全資訊即可 接下來輸入個人資訊 下面會要CSR, 一般選擇系統生成 完成之後提交稽核,這裡的稽核就是要驗證網址是不是自己的 點選

阿里免費 SSL 證書到期後更新證書操作步驟

今天早上我發現我的網站不能正常的通過 https 訪問了,被谷歌瀏覽器攔截,提示隱私設定錯誤。然後我們 Safari 瀏覽器進行訪問,提示此連結非私人連線,同樣的被攔截了。然後我根據谷歌瀏覽器的提示資訊,發現是我的 https 安全證書已在昨天過期。於是我就緊急進行證書升級,本文是我的升級操作過程,

域名阿里免費ssl證書配置安裝

去阿里雲盾申請 成功後下載 有三個檔案******.com_public.crt ******.com.key *******.com_chain.crt Apache安裝配置SSL證書方法教程(普通版) https://www .wosign.com/support/ssl-Apache1.htm 把

阿里免費SSL證書對IOS描述檔案mobileconfig的簽名認證

1.購買阿里雲免費證書:跳轉 阿里雲SSL證書 2.選擇免費選項如圖 3.等等稽核成功下載 4.選擇其他下載證書,開啟壓縮包內容如下 首先找到公鑰public.pem檔案,一串數字字尾為key的,一串數字字尾為pem的祕鑰檔案 5.重新命名: publ

申請阿里免費https

進入阿里雲賬戶---安全(雲盾)---證書服務---購買證書---選擇免費DV SSL--購買將生成的rem 和key ,放到nginx裡面的conf ,新建cert資料夾裡。在nginx裡面配置好,就Ok了。server { listen 443; serv

阿里伺服器(Windows32作業系統)及配置方法

以前一直想弄個伺服器玩玩,昨天閒來無事,無意間看到了阿里雲,點選註冊進去看了看,有學生優惠活動。 下面的內容是從別處百度得來,寫這個內容純屬自己個人總結,若涉及版權問題,請原諒。 一.通過學生優惠價格購買雲伺服器 1.進入阿里雲官網https://www.aliyun

阿里免費購買SSL證書,nginx無縫升級https

最近在升級交流學習社群,覺得有必要升級成https.以下是自己在升級中記錄。 以下包括以下部分: 一、阿里雲免費購買SSL證書 1、自己在阿里雲申請了免費的,然後自己支付0元,購買了SSL證書 2、我選擇DNS驗證 3、在SSL證書中,下載cert證書,然後放到nginx伺服器上 二、ngin

實現基於阿里負載均衡https證書

一、https協議流程:1、生成伺服器證書:1.1、生成祕鑰檔案mykey:keytool -genkey -alias tomcat7.0 -keyalg RSA -keystore mykey -storepass Zyg15328420313 -keypass Zyg

lnamp服務架構配置多站點+阿里免費證書

1.關於lnamp架構介紹 linux+nginx+apache+mysql+php 2.給大家分享一個這種架構的一鍵安裝指令碼ezhttp 下載地址:https://www.oschina.net/p/ezhttp 備用下載地址:https://github.com/cent

tomcat搭建https伺服器+阿里免費證書

部落格原由 由於專案的需要,需要在阿里雲ECS(windows伺服器)上搭建後臺。搭建成功後發現不能訪問 http://www.xxx.com/出現以下圖片,需要備案才可以,可是備案需要20個工作日才可以。。。 這怎麼辦呢,那直接用ip如何呢,http:

免費好用的阿裏證書服務(https證書)申請及Nginx配置

write man del remote worker work gen params 申請 購買 阿裏雲控制臺 然後 購買就可以了 Nginx配置 我直接把我的配置貼出來,其實這個在阿裏雲裏面介紹的有,就是找到https那裏,然後打開註釋,改一下配置就好了 user

Nginx 配置 pathinfo, 阿里免費申請的 ssl 證書

本博主轉載前必先親自考證,深惡痛絕百度CP之流,有問題請與我聯絡。 專案使用thinkphp5, nginx 要支援pathinfo, 作為小程式的介面,當然也少不了ssl 證書。 阿里雲可申請免費ssl 證書,所以就整了一個。 廢話不多說,直接上多站點程式碼, 將以下程式碼放入vhos

阿里免費申請SSL證書

最近想玩玩微信小程式,發現在使用wx.request介面時必須用HTTPS(Hypertext Transfer Protocol over Secure Socket Layer)。Apache預設是不支援SSL的,必須自行新增配置。 SSL是WEB伺服器和瀏覽器之間以加解

阿里免費申請SSL證書 IIS安裝與使用!

SSL解釋:       SSL(Secure Sockets Layer 安全套接層),及其繼任者傳輸層安全(Transport Layer Security,TLS)是為網路通訊提供安全及資料完整性的一種安全協議。TLS與SSL在傳輸層對網路連線進行加密。 準備條件:

Windows 64位為wampserver或phpstudy 騰訊免費SSL證書安裝

目錄  如文章對你有用的話請點個 贊 1.下載證書 解壓 後複製Apache資料夾 2.開啟httpd.ini配置檔案 LoadModule ssl_module mod

阿里免費SSL,網站免費升級為https。【簡單 快速】

準備 (這裡以我的配置為例)     1、備案過的域名     2、去阿里雲上面申請一個ssl證書     3、專案頁面釋出在 nginx 上(其他的服務也可以,ssl證書支援任何伺服器)

Apache2.4.7配置https,解決阿里證書配置之痛

Chrome封殺80網站(http),逼迫小網開啟443(https)。如果沒有這個的話就會被瀏覽器或電腦管家認定為不安全的網站,當然可繼續訪問,但是當很多人投訴你的網站就會立刻想到與木馬病毒相關的東西,認為這不是一個好網站。 阿里雲伺服器開啟http

阿里申請SSL證書以及配置Tomcat為Https請求

1、首先進入阿里雲官網(https://www.aliyun.com)找到安全→CA證書服務進行免費申請。 2、證書型別選擇“免費型DV SSL”,然後立即購買,等十分鐘左右就會通過稽核下發證書。 3